Food safety eateries’ body says fix the problem, not the blame

Several prominent Indian restaurants face hygiene violation allegations from consumers and regulators. NRAI president emphasizes fixing problems and fair enforcement over blame and reputational damage. Social media scrutiny and regulatory actions are impacting well-known food establishments across the country. Enforcement must follow legal procedures, offering businesses a chance to rectify issues. This situation highlights the ongoing need for stringent food safety standards and transparent oversight.
